President Nixon attempted to initiate a telephone call to Reverend Billy Graham, who was reportedly staying at a hotel in Los Angeles. The White House operator informed the President that Graham could not be reached at his room, leading to a decision to postpone the outreach until the following day. No further substantive matters were discussed during this brief administrative exchange.
On June 12, 1973, White House operator and President Richard M. Nixon talked on the telephone at 10:18 pm. The White House Telephone taping system captured this recording, which is known as Conversation 040-045 of the White House Tapes.
